The Zero-Click Paradox
Search has changed. More than half of Google searches today don’t result in a click to any website. Instead, users find their answer directly on the results page in featured snippets, People Also Ask boxes, AI overviews, knowledge panels, and more. This phenomenon, known as zero-click content, has left marketers asking: Is this killing traffic or opening a new frontier for SEO? The truth is, zero-click search is not the death of SEO, it’s a shift. And like every algorithm update before it, those who adapt will thrive. Let’s break down what zero-click content really is, how it impacts SEO, and what strategies can help you win in this environment.
Zero-click content refers to search results where the user finds the information they need directly on the Search Engine Results Page (SERP), without clicking through to a website.

Instead of viewing zero-click searches as a loss, forward-thinking brands see them as an opportunity.
1. Brand Visibility Without Clicks
Even if the user doesn’t click, your brand is front and center in the SERP. For emerging brands, this visibility can be more valuable than a single click.
2. Authority and Trust Building
Being featured in AI overviews or a featured snippet signals to users that your brand is credible. This creates long-term trust and higher chances of future engagement.
3. Increased Voice Search Exposure
Zero-click answers are the foundation of voice search responses. If your content powers these answers, you win presence in a growing search channel.
4. Enhanced Discovery via AI Overviews
As Google integrates AI into SERPs, brands that adapt their content for conversational queries and structured answers will dominate.

Zero-click content isn’t killing SEO it’s reshaping it. Yes, raw traffic numbers may decline for some queries, but the upside is immense. Visibility, trust, and authority are increasingly measured by how often your brand powers AI-driven and zero-click answers.
The brands that win are those that stop chasing just clicks and start optimizing for visibility, authority, and future engagement.
